Our team has been utilizing Solidworks PDM since 2020. It’s setup on our engineering departments servers so we have to VPN to get access. It takes some work to setup but it’s been way better the GrabCAD.

Wiring is a very time consuming process, especially if you don't have a schematic designed (in Rapid Harness for example) and if you aren't using a power distribution device then wiring fuses and relays will add to the time. I've done several harnesses now and still realize new ways of doing things. And yea tuning is a whole other ball game, lots of work, especially in just getting the engine set up to turn on and idle.

Fair enough if that’s what they’re doing. We also use a drexler, however we just designed an adapter that mesh’s the splines on the drexler and bolts to an off the shelf sprocket. Makes it easy to swap to different sizes during testing and easy replacement due to wear and tear.
